Abstract
A memory card has an integral battery with an energy capacity sufficient to power an electronic device. The memory card battery provides power to the electronic device while the memory card is electrically connected to the electronic device. An electronic device utilizes a memory card having an integral battery and receives power from the integral battery. A system comprising the memory card and a battery-charging unit provides power to the electronic device and recharges the memory card battery. A method of powering an electronic device comprises using the memory card battery to power the electronic device while the card is electrically connected to the device.
